United Nations say 'at least 10 bullets' hit aid vehicle in Gaza

The United Nations' World Food Programme temporarily suspended the movement of its employees across the Gaza strip, saying at least 10 bullets had struck one of its clearly marked vehicles as it approached an Israeli military checkpoint. The WFP said its convoy received 'multiple clearances by Israeli authorities to approach' the Wadi Gaza bridge checkpoint. Bullets hit one of the vehicles, but no one inside was hurt. The IDF did not immediately respond to a request for comment about the incident
